What is the difference between Project Management Interior Design vs Interior Designer?

AspectProject Management Interior DesignInterior Designer
CredentialsProject management certifications, interior design knowledgeInterior design certifications, portfolio
Work EnvironmentOversees projects, coordinates teamsDesigns spaces, works directly with clients
Industry UsageUsed in construction, renovation projectsUsed in residential, commercial interior design

Project Management Interior Design focuses on coordinating and overseeing interior design projects, ensuring timelines and budgets are met. Interior Designers primarily create and implement design concepts for spaces. While both roles require interior design knowledge, project managers emphasize coordination and management, whereas interior designers focus on aesthetics and design details.

Job description

Basic Function: Execute conceptual interior architecture designs, ensuring projects meet aesthetic, functional, and client-specific goals.

Essential Duties/Responsibilities included but not limited to:

  • Collaborate with clients and project managers to gather design requirements for new construction, renovations or alterations.
  • Prepare, revise, and update design documents during schematic, design development and construction document phases.
  • Select and specify interior architectural materials, finishes, furniture, artwork, equipment, lighting and related elements as required by each project’s unique scope.
  • Coordinate lighting and color schemes to create cohesive design solutions.
  • Manage and execute design assignments efficiently within established deadlines.
  • Develop innovative, practical, and safe design concepts that align with client goals and project budgets.
  • Render conceptual design ideas.
  • Analyze programming data to execute space planning concepts and optimize space utilization based on client’s objectives and space constraints.
  • Participate in team meetings to coordinate and present design options and ideas.
  • Ensure project deliverables adhere to industry best practices, company quality standards, and schedule. .
  • Integrate sustainable design principles into all projects.

Qualifications/Skills:

  • Proficient in Revit.
  • Knowledgeable in 3-D rendering programs (Twinmotion, Enscape, or similar).
  • Strong visualization, organizational, and problem-solving abilities.
  • Ability to combine aesthetics with functionality and building mechanics.
  • Excellent interpersonal and collaboration skills.
  • Experience working in deadline-driven, fast-paced environments.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, Teams, etc.).

Education/Experience:

  • A bachelor’s degree in interior design or equivalent years of experience is preferred.
  • NCIDQ Certification Preferred.
  • 5+ years of experience.
